Since January, Christian Lander has been skewering a certain subsection of the population in his wildly popular blog, “Stuff White People Like.”  A few days ago, he posted Stuff White People Like #108, “Appearing to Enjoy Classical Music,” which naturally enough got my attention. He essentially writes that white people to go classical music concerts to impress others rather than to actually listen to the music.

If you’re like me and you work in the arts field specifically to hear Handel arias and Bach cantatas and five-hour operas like Les Troyens and Die Meistersinger as often as possible, the column is a big ouch—and also devastatingly funny. (One of my favorites lines is Lander’s description of symphony concerts where “white couples have paid upwards of $80 for the right to dress up and sit in a chair for hour reading every word in the program.” Yeah, we’ve all seen this countless times, and it’s one of my pet peeves.)

For Lander, 2008 has provided at least 15 minutes of fame. He wrote his first blog entry on January 18 (#1, Coffee), following up with things like non-profit organizations (#12), microbreweries (#23), the Sunday New York Times (#46), arts degrees (#47), and threatening to move to Canada (#75). Soon the site was logging millions of visitors, and he quickly got a Random House book deal, with Stuff White People Like in bookstores on July 1. read more
